A cylindrical timber is 5 meters long. When it is sawed into 4 sections, the surface area increases by 12 square decimeters. The volume of this timber is______ If it takes nine minutes to cut it into four sections, it takes nine minutes to cut it into six sections______ Minutes


(1) 5 meters = 50 decimeters, 12 △ 2 × 3 × 50, = 12 △ 6 × 50, = 100 (cubic decimeters); (2) 9 △ 4-1 × (6-1), = 9 △ 3 × 5, = 15 (minutes); answer: the volume of this wood is 100 cubic decimeters. It takes 15 minutes to saw it into six sections
